Original title: US Stocks Drop as Tech Rout Deepens, Hurt by Climbing Yields
US stocks fell on Tuesday, extending losses from Friday as Big Tech names declined and yields on 10-year Treasuries advanced, pressured by Bloomberg Terminal mounting corporate issuance. The S&P 500 Index touched a session low, dropping 1.5% at 12:05 p.m. in New York, with all but one of 11 industry groups declining, led by technology firms. The Nasdaq 100 Index lost 1.8%, while a gauge of Magnificent Seven companies slid 2.3%. The Cboe VIX Index rose to near 20. The 10-year Treasury yield rose to 4.28%.
